History & Origins

Mothering Sunday

Mothering Sunday is a special day in the Christian calendar dedicated to honouring mothers, motherhood, and the role of women in the Church and society.

Traditionally, it originates from the fourth Sunday of Lent, when Christians were encouraged to return to their "mother church" and appreciate both the Church and biological mothers.

The Nigerian Context

CWO in Nigeria

In the Catholic Church in Nigeria, the celebration is uniquely organized and widely coordinated by the Catholic Women Organisation (CWO). Mothering Sunday is a joyful and spiritual occasion marked by:

  • Special thanksgiving Masses
  • Recognition and appreciation of mothers' sacrifices
  • Processions and active participation in the liturgy
  • Cultural displays and charity works
